1999 Accord V6 - Service Question
 
Hi All.

My mother-in-law has a 1999 Accord V6. It's garage kept and she only has about 40,000 miles on it. Dealer serviced since purchased. At her last service, dealer suggested timing belt and 3 outer belts, front engine seals, valve cover gasket, and water pump replacement. All for the value price of $1,060. Oh yeah, a pollen filter replacement for an additional $94.00, too.

Now I know we should consider the age of the car and not just the mileage, but in your all educated opinions, is all that service necessary? It seems a bit excessive.

I personally would not. With only 40k miles I would say that everything should be fine, it sounds like she takes good care of her car. When the time comes to do this maintence, yes, everything they listed is how it is usually done. Usually the timing belt needs to be changed at more than double her current mileage. If your are concerned about the time frame do a visual inspection of the outer belts and look for cracking and the usual signs of a worn belt. This will give you at least an idea of the status.

service is 8 years or 105K unless she is idle a lot or the dealer REMOVED the inspection cover and saw that maybe the belt has signs of wear, change it next year when it will be due.

IF that belt breaks, you are looking at a min of $3K for a rebuild.......
